Block
#13,585,781
6h
11 txs1,150 confs
Transactions
11
Total Output
₳13,535,723.76
$2.07M
Fees
₳3.26
Size
13.42 KB
13,739 bytes
Details
Hash
2ce2c52c15c6e86f895708f6aa147cae62244e227ff47eb489d95c7d6e4a47a5
Epoch / Slot
Epoch 638 · slot 190,626,072 · epoch-slot 373,272
Timestamp
6h · Tue, 23 Jun 2026 05:26:03 GMT
Block producer
VRF key
vrf_vk1r…6s07pvdh
Op cert
7093b49c…a71885bd
Op cert counter
27